Though we did not stay at Country Country, we ate there as well. While doing so I took the opportunity to look over the small grounds. It's a long narrow property (as many are in Negril) with cottages on either side of a wide walkway. None of them looks as though they had any view and none looked very large either. With one child we generally look for at least a bedroom and pullout. Also........though there was a small sitting area up above the beach near the restaurant, there is not much hotel beach as again the property is narrow. Since Ivan there may be even less debth as well. As for cleanliness and management, I remember it to be very good on both counts as far as the restaurant was concerned. Food was very good! My only warning would be that you will likely hit college Spring Break time. Have you been to Negril before? If not, I would hate for your first trip to be during Spring Break if you don't know what you're in for. The heaviest partying will be closer to Negril so it may be alright but it is something you should factor in. Country Country is probably not the kind of place that caters to breakers but you never know.
